大学计算机基础第三版实验素材-陈振第3章节第七讲.pptVIP

大学计算机基础第三版实验素材-陈振第3章节第七讲.ppt

  1. 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
  2. 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  3. 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  4. 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  5. 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  6. 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  7. 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
馋死 PPT研究院 POWERPOINT ACADEMY * * 计算机基础科学系 尚辅网 / 信息科学与工程学院 2012.8 第3章 计算机软件系统 第七讲 计算机软件基础与程序设计语言 主要教学内容 计算机软件基础知识 1 程序设计语言 2 小 结 4 程序的构建与执行 3 学习目标 1 了解指令、程序与软件的概念及相互之间的关系。掌握软件的分类方法。 2 了解程序设计语言的分类,程序的构建方法与执行方法。 重点与难点 程序与软件的概念;机器语言、汇编语言与高级语言的优缺点为本讲的重点。 指令 给计算机的命令称指令。一种指令对应计算机的一种操作。指令由操作码和操作数构成,操作码表示执行何种操作,操作数表示操作数的存储地址或操作对象。 所谓指令集,就是CPU中用来计算和控制计算机系统的一套指令的集合,而每一种新型的CPU在设计时就规定了一系列与其他硬件电路相配合的指令系统。指令集的先进与否,关系到CPU的性能发挥,它也是CPU性能体现的一个重要标志。 1.指令、程序和软件 1.1 指令 CPU的指令集从主流的体系结构上分为精简指令集(Reduced Instruction Set Computing,RISC)和复杂指令集(Complex Instruction Set Computing,CISC)。 1.2 程序 在我国《计算机软件保护条例》中把程序定义为:为了得到某种结果而可以由计算机等具有信息处理能力的装置执行的代码化指令序列,或者可被自动转换成代码化指令序列的符号化指令序列或者符号化语句序列。简单地说,程序是可以连续执行,并能够完成一定任务的指令的集合,它是人与机器之间进行交流的语言。 1.3 软件 计算机软件(Computer Software)是指计算机程序与数据及相关文档资料的总称。程序是计算任务的处理对象和处理规则的描述;数据是程序要处理的对象;文档是为了便于了解程序所需的阐明性资料。程序必须装入机器内部才能工作,数据必须调入计算机内存才能被处理,文档一般是给人看的,不一定装入机器。 1.4 指令、程序与软件的关系 程序 指令 指令 指令 …… 指令 数据 文档 软件 2. 软件的分类 系统软件:是指控制和协调计算机及其外部设备,支持应用软件的开发和运行的软件,其主要的功能是调度、监控和维护系统等。 软件的分类 应用软件:应用软件是用户为解决各种实际问题而编制的计算机应用程序及有关资料。 2. 软件的分类 系统软件: (1)操作系统软件,如Windows XP、Windows 2000、Linux、UNIX等。 (2)各种语言的处理程序,如汇编语言、高级语言、编译程序等。 (3)各种服务性程序,如机器的调试、故障检查和诊断程序、杀毒程序等。 (4)各种数据库管理系统,如SQL Server、Oracle、Informix等。 应用软件: (1)用于科学计算方面的数学计算软件包、统计软件包。 (2)文字处理软件,如金山文字处理软件、Office 2003。 (3)图像处理软件,如Photoshop、动画处理软件(3ds max)。 (4)各种财务管理软件,如税务管理软件、工业控制软件、辅助教育等专用软件。 3. 程序设计语言的分类 语言是为了交流的需要!! 3. 1 程序设计语言的分类 机器语言 汇编语言 高级语言 专用语言 3. 1 程序设计语言的分类 1 、机器语言 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 1600000100 0000000000000000 0000000000000010 0000000000000101 0000000000001011 0000000000010010 11011111 000000000001010111111011 0000000000010111 0000000000011110 000000

您可能关注的文档

文档评论(0)

开心农场 + 关注
实名认证
文档贡献者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档